Transaction ffc8ca13f2886336ab2e3a426bd3610ff1d3c07b6f8a996882b99140fccd4c4e
1 Input
1 Output
-
ffc8ca13f2886336ab2e3a426bd3610ff1d3c07b6f8a996882b99140fccd4c4e:0
- value
- 51100
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f15d126879b84f002e02a036b897aebdd8a66bd6 OP_EQUAL
- address
- 3PhEGXN6jy65YTA93rAeUB5nNNcPKvHRhg